Caractéristics:

This upright bar table in recycled oak characterized by the curved and flared shape of its foot comes partly from the reconditioning of large barrels. The brushed stainless steel ring is more reminiscent of the origin of wood.

The brown traces on the feet are the witnesses of the heater of the cooper which is found in depth even after planing. Depending on the colour variants the oak used comes either from the recycling of barrels or from wood leaving the sawmill.

Dimensions:

Height: 110 cm. Tray diameter 65 cm. Tray thickness 22 mm.

The base, bent and flared on the ground, gives the standing eat in recycled wood of the tastevin range at the same time great stability and elegance for a slender and supple silhouette. Several heights allow to create sets with the different models of bar stool.

Origin of the wood: It is by splitting the oak wood that we obtain the merrain intended for the manufacture of barrels. It is by recycling the wood of large barrels that we obtain the standing eat of the collection of furniture in merrain. The staves (vertical blades of the barrel) are used for the legs, The lid of the barrel is used to make the tray.

Recycling and manufacturing: the different stages. To recycle the dowels at the foot of the table, they must be calibrated in width to be able to carry out the following operations: Planing according to the curved shape, chamfering and drilling at the passage of the metal circles and tenoning at the high end. A wooden disc is morteasible to be assembled with the staves transformed into legs.

To recycle the barrel lid and make the table top eat standing, it must first be disassembled. Each element is then planed and planed. The tray is reformed by gluing the different parts after machining the fields.

Finishing of the wood: The staves of the barrel become table legs are then brushed. The lid of the barrel became Plateau is planed again then finely sanded.

The colour zones left by the wine in the wood are uneven from one copy to another, depending on the state of the wood, the intensity of the planing and sanding, and the provenance of the wine. Then apply a two-layer water-soluble varnish.

Metal ring: This is a piece of boiler made to measure and reminiscent of the circle of the barrel. It allows the assembly of the legs of the upright eater made of recycled wood in the lower part. It is made of brushed stainless steel.
